Story & provenance
Sensible Budget All-Rounder
Released in 2020, Jordan Jumpman 2020 arrived in Jordan Brand's annual team-model cycle, positioned below the premium signatures. The design intent centered on offering straightforward performance value with enough Zoom pop to feel athletic without becoming complicated. Notable versions or talking points included its budget positioning and wide availability. In community memory, the shoe is usually remembered for sensible all-around playability, especially for players who prioritize traction and fit over luxury cushion. It also helps mark a specific turning point inside that line, because the shoe shows what the brand prioritized at that moment rather than simply copying the previous release.
